The letter from Croydon’s Labour leader (October 29) covered a wide range of topics.
However, many will not forget the big council tax rises when his party ran the council, one being 27 per cent. That when the Government wanted us to believe inflation was its lowest since the year dot.
At least David Cameron hasn’t presided over a huge personal debt bubble built on soaring house prices.
Many first-time buyers have been priced out of the housing market for years. Let’s hope that recession will not force too many out of their jobs so they cannot take advantage of falling property prices.
